Discover Horbury Junction
Horbury Junction is a suburb located in Yorkshire, England, governed by Wakefield Council. Situated within the WF4 postcode area, it forms part of the Wakefield district. The area is known for its historical railway significance, offering convenient transport links, making it a notable point of interest for visitors and residents alike.
